L
Linda Dubbs Review of Bioservuk ltd
Bioservuk ltd is a great company to work with. The...
Bioservuk ltd is a great company to work with. Their team provides excellent service and their products are of high quality. I am very satisfied with their prompt response and delivery. I highly recommend Bioservuk ltd!

Comments: